Gift Aid Awareness Day 2020 #TickTheBox
Today – Thursday, October 8 – is Gift Aid Awareness Day.
The ME Association, together with most of this country’s charities, need people more than ever to remember to tick the Gift Aid Box when they make a donation.
A think tank called the Charity Finance Group tell us that overall donations to charities have fallen by over £10billion this year because of the pandemic.
They say that Gift Aid is worth £1.3billion to the UK’s charities – but surprisingly £560million of that goes unclaimed every year.
So, if you are a UK taxpayer, please remember to tick the Gift Aid box when making a donation – you will need to complete a declaration that includes your full HOME address and postcode.
